ABBOTTABAD: A key fugitive accused in the abduction and murder case of Dr Warda Mushtaq has reportedly been killed in a police encounter, sources said on Sunday.

According to initial reports, the encounter took place in the Thandiani -Kundla area, where police engaged armed suspects during an operation. During the exchange of fire, Shamrez, described by authorities as a dangerous and most-wanted accused in the Dr Warda case, was killed on the spot, the sources added.

Dr Warda, a medical officer, was abducted and later brutally murdered in Abbottabad earlier this month, a crime that triggered widespread outrage across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, particularly among the medical community and civil society. Following the incident, multiple suspects were arrested, while Shamrez had remained at large and was declared a prime fugitive in the case.

Security had been heightened in the region after the killing, and the provincial government had also constituted a Joint Investigation Team (JIT) to ensure a transparent and comprehensive probe into the high-profile case.

Police officials have yet to issue an official statement confirming the details of the encounter. Further information is expected after completion of legal formalities and verification of the incident.
